数控复合机编程代码是什么
-
数控复合机编程代码是一种用于控制数控复合机工作的指令序列。这些代码由一系列的指令和参数组成,用于告诉机器如何进行加工操作。下面是数控复合机编程代码的一般结构和常见指令的介绍。
数控复合机编程代码的一般结构如下:
-
程序开始指令(Program Start):通常以“O”或“N”开始,用于标识程序的起始点。
-
设置坐标系指令(Coordinate System Setting):用于定义工件坐标系或机床坐标系,包括原点坐标、旋转角度等。
-
加工方式指令(Machining Mode Setting):用于设置加工方式,如切削进给速度、进给方式、刀具半径补偿等。
-
进给速度指令(Feedrate Setting):用于设置进给速度,控制工件在加工过程中的移动速度。
-
刀具补偿指令(Tool Compensation):用于修正刀具的几何误差,保证加工精度。
-
加工指令(Machining Operation):包括切削指令(G代码)和辅助功能指令(M代码),用于控制切削工具的运动和加工过程中的辅助功能。
-
循环指令(Looping):用于实现重复的加工操作,提高加工效率。
-
程序结束指令(Program End):用于标识程序的结束点。
常见的数控复合机编程指令包括:
-
直线插补指令(G01):用于控制工件沿直线路径进行切削。
-
圆弧插补指令(G02/G03):用于控制工件沿圆弧路径进行切削。
-
切削进给速度指令(F):用于设置工件的切削进给速度。
-
刀具半径补偿指令(G40/G41/G42):用于修正刀具的几何误差,保证加工精度。
-
刀具卸载指令(M05):用于停止切削工具的旋转。
-
切削冷却液开启指令(M08):用于开启切削冷却液供给。
-
切削冷却液关闭指令(M09):用于关闭切削冷却液供给。
以上是数控复合机编程代码的一般结构和常见指令的介绍。编写数控复合机编程代码需要熟悉机床的操作规范和加工工艺要求,以确保加工过程的安全和加工质量的稳定性。
1年前 -
-
数控复合机编程代码是一种用于控制数控复合机运动和操作的指令集合。这些代码以特定的格式书写,通过输入到数控复合机的控制系统中,以实现对机床的控制和操作。
数控复合机编程代码主要包括以下几个方面:
-
G代码:G代码是数控编程中最基本的代码。它用于定义数控复合机的运动轨迹和操作方式。例如,G00表示快速定位,G01表示直线插补,G02和G03表示圆弧插补等。G代码可以控制数控复合机的运动速度、切削速度、刀具进给等。
-
M代码:M代码用于控制数控复合机的辅助功能和操作。例如,M03表示主轴正转,M04表示主轴反转,M05表示主轴停止等。M代码可以控制数控复合机的主轴转速、冷却液开关、刀具换位等辅助功能。
-
T代码:T代码用于选择数控复合机上的刀具。每个T代码后面跟着一个刀具号,用于告诉数控系统使用哪个刀具进行加工。
-
F代码:F代码用于定义数控复合机的进给速度。它表示刀具在工件表面上运动的速度。F代码后面的数值表示进给速度的具体数值。
-
S代码:S代码用于定义数控复合机的主轴转速。它表示主轴旋转的速度。S代码后面的数值表示主轴转速的具体数值。
以上是数控复合机编程代码的主要内容。在实际的编程过程中,根据具体的加工要求和机床的功能,还可以使用其他的代码进行更精细的控制和操作。编程人员需要熟悉不同代码的含义和用法,才能正确地编写数控复合机的编程代码。
1年前 -
-
数控复合机编程代码是一种用于控制数控复合机工作的程序代码。数控复合机是一种通过计算机控制的机械设备,可以根据预定的程序进行自动操作,完成复合加工任务。编程代码是指在数控复合机上进行操作时所使用的代码,通过编写和输入这些代码,可以实现对数控复合机的控制和指导。
数控复合机编程代码主要分为以下几个部分:启动代码、坐标系设定代码、刀具设定代码、切削参数设定代码、加工轨迹代码、循环代码、结束代码等。
-
启动代码:启动代码用于启动数控复合机,包括电源开启、系统初始化等操作。启动代码一般是固定的,可以直接调用。
-
坐标系设定代码:坐标系设定代码用于设定数控复合机的坐标系。坐标系设定代码包括坐标轴的原点设定、坐标系的转换等操作。在编写坐标系设定代码时,需要根据具体的加工需求进行设定。
-
刀具设定代码:刀具设定代码用于设定数控复合机所使用的刀具。刀具设定代码包括刀具的选择、刀具的安装等操作。在编写刀具设定代码时,需要根据具体的加工需求选择合适的刀具。
-
切削参数设定代码:切削参数设定代码用于设定数控复合机的切削参数。切削参数设定代码包括切削速度、进给速度、切削深度等参数的设定。在编写切削参数设定代码时,需要根据具体的加工需求进行设定。
-
加工轨迹代码:加工轨迹代码用于描述数控复合机的加工轨迹。加工轨迹代码包括加工路径、加工顺序等信息。在编写加工轨迹代码时,需要根据具体的加工需求进行描述。
-
循环代码:循环代码用于循环执行加工操作。循环代码可以用于实现批量加工、连续加工等操作。在编写循环代码时,需要根据具体的加工需求进行设定。
-
结束代码:结束代码用于结束数控复合机的工作。结束代码一般是固定的,用于关闭电源、释放资源等操作。
以上是数控复合机编程代码的主要内容和流程。在实际编写代码时,需要根据具体的加工需求和数控复合机的要求进行编写,保证代码的正确性和可靠性。
1年前 -